Problem- A food storage chamber requires a refrigeration system of 15-ton capacity operating at an evaporator temperature of -8°C and a condenser temperature of 30°C. Refrigerant ammonia (R-717) is used and the system operates at saturated conditions. Determine:

(a) C.O.P.

(b) Refrigerant flow rate

(c) Rate of heat removed by the condenser.

Repeat problem, with the refrigerant subcooled by 5°C before entering the expansion valve, and the vapor superheated by 6°C.
